iAim

This mod reskins the crosshairs to hopefully be more easier to look at. This is a very simple modification, I've been using this for awhile now tweaking it here and there. It makes shooting much more easier, from shooting around corners and shooting on top of hills, you can easily see if your shot will hit or miss.

I may improve, or release different crosshair styles if this is something people would like to see more of.



Features:
  • 3 different crosshair styles.
  • In the color of: Red, Blue, Gray, Yellow. Gray + Yellow look best imo.
  • Bullet tracers changed to Yellow.
  • Good/Bad hit Crosshairs have been changed to be more visible. Easier than looking at a tiny dot.


Installation:
  1. Extract "media" folder to C:\Program Files (x86)\Steam\steamapps\common\RunningWithRifles
  2. Say yes to overwrite, if you don't get popup dialog asking to overwrite then you copied the folder to the wrong directory.
  3. To uninstall, verify the game files by going into the game's properties in your steam library.


Changelog:
Spoiler:
- ver0.1 initial release | Oct 21st
- ver0.2 modified existing Crosshair and added a 2nd Crosshair | Oct 31st
- ver0.3 added new dotted Crosshair | Nov 10th
